ONEANDZERO Wiki
Login:
Password:
You will be given a post of trust and responsibility.

Python Seminar #

파이썬은 객체지향 기능을 강력히지원하는 대화형 인터프리터 언어입니다. 라고 파이썬 책 맨 앞에 나와있군요(...)
좀더 간단히 덧붙여보면 파이썬은 아주 쉽고 빠른 언어입니다. 다만 여기서 빠르다는건 코드의 실행시간이 아닌 개발기간입니다:D 코드의 실행시간은 다른 언어에비해 상당히 늦은걸로 알고있습니다만... 그런얘기는 세미나때 하구요, 뭐 암튼 그런겁니다. 쉽고 빠르게 배울수 있는 관계로 파이썬을 이용해 다소 문법적인 부분에 치우졌었던 기존 세미나에서 벗어나 프로그래밍의 방법론적인 부분까지 공부했으면 합니다.

1 Python Seminar
1.1 Notice
1.2 메모
1.3 Lecture
1.3.1 연산자
1.3.2 제어문/반복문
1.3.3 자료형
1.3.4 함수
1.3.5 클래스
1.3.6 모듈
1.4 etc.
2 파일 업로드 플러그인

1.1 Notice #

파이썬 공식 홈페이지 : http://python.org/
ActivePython 홈페이지 : http://www.activestate.com/Products/ActivePython/

1.2 메모 #

인원이 많아 스터디와 세미나로 나눕니다
스터디 대상자: 이동익(진행) 정성균 박지하 이상휘
세미나 대상자: 노진상 어성욱 김주호 정의균




각자 되는시간을 밑에 적어주시기 바랍니다
  • 서동환: 화요일 안됨. 목요일은 5시이후. 나머진 다됨
  • 정의균 : 월요일 7시 이후, 화요일 9시 이후, 수요일 7시 이후, 목요일 9시 이후, 금요일 5시 이후, 토요일 : 언제나 가능합니다. 일요일 : 곤란합니다. C세미나 시간은 아직 미정입니다.
  • 정성균 : 화, 목 7시 이후에 가능합니다.
  • 이상휘 : 화, 목 되기는 합니다만 수업이 10시반에 끝납니다 뭥미.-_-.. 점심시간은 어떤지. 월 화 목 점심시간 가능합니당. -L-
  • 이동익: 화 목 점심시간-2시까지 가능, 화 오후 9시 이후, 목 오후 8시 이후 가능. 금요일 저녁 이후.
  • 김주호 : 화, 목 9시이후 수요일은 불가 나머지는 C세미나일정이 어떻게 될지 몰라서 모르겠어요
  • 어성욱 : 월요일 5시 이후, 수요일5시이후, 목요일 7시이후, 금토일 가능
  • 박지하: 화 목 금 저녁 5시이후 굿입니다.
    노진상: c언어 세미나 공지글에 올린 것과 마찬가지로
    화 5~7시 반, 목 6시 이후, 금 4시 이후
    만약 한다면 주말에도 괜찮습니다.

    1.3 Lecture #

    1.3.1 연산자 #

    • 산술연산자 : , -, *, /, //(몫연산자), **(제곱연산자), %
      /!\ 나 --는 없음
    • 관계연산자 : ==,!\, >, <, >=, <=
      • 2 < x < 6 처럼 복합하여 사용도 가능
    • 논리연산자 : not, and, or
      • 객체의 진리값 : 0(정수형), 0.0(실수형), ""(빈 문자열), ()(빈 튜플), [](빈 리스트), {}(빈 사전), None('아무것도 아니다'를 나타내는 파이썬 내장 객체)는 모두 False, 그 나머지는 모두 True

    1.3.2 제어문/반복문 #

    • if
    if <조건문> :
     <문1>
    elif <조건문> :
     <문2>
    else :
     <문3>
    • for
    for <타겟> in <객체> 
     <문1>
    else :
     <문2>
    • while
    while <조건문> :
     <문1>
    else:
     <문2>
    • continue

    • break

    1.3.3 자료형 #

    • 수치자료형
      • 정수형
      • 실수형
      • 허수형 : 정확히말하면 자료형은 아님 기본 제공 모듈로 존재
    • 문자열
      • 한줄
      • 여러줄
    • 리스트
    • 튜플
    • 사전

    1.3.4 함수 #

    1.3.5 클래스 #

    1.3.6 모듈 #

    1.4 etc. #

    2 파일 업로드 플러그인 #


    Replace original file
    Rename if it already exist

    프로젝트용 파일 업로드 방법:
    해당 프로젝트 메인페이지에서 파일 업로드 플러그인을 사용합니다.
    그 후 UploadedFiles에서 해당 프로젝트 폴더로 들어가
    업로드한 파일 이름에 마우스 오른클릭을 하여 바로가기 복사를 한 뒤
    원하는 페이지에 붙여넣으시면 됩니다.

    Valid XHTML 1.0! Valid CSS! powered by MoniWiki
    last modified 2008-03-26 17:06:30
    Processing time 0.0406 sec